Linz, Österreich - On June 17, 2025, the Upper Austria is looking for. State Fire Brigade Association in Linz An IT application manager or an IT application manager (m/f/d) in a junior position. This position is a full -time job with a weekly working time of 40 hours. The new employee is intended to ensure that the interference-free operation of the online fire brigade management systems and the Office365 environment are guaranteed. In addition, the documentation of extensions and functionalities is one of the essential tasks.

Another central responsibility includes Helpdesk support for users and support with various software applications. The range of tasks also includes participation in objectives, optimization and the new development of processes and projects. The processing of (partial) projects and work packages is also the responsibility of the new employee, who will act as the main person.

Requirements and qualifications

In order to be considered for this position, completed technical training in the field of computer science is required, ideally with relevant work experience. Important knowledge includes operating systems (Microsoft, Linux), database and SQL skills as well as basic knowledge of web technologies and scripting languages such as JavaScript and PHP. A safe handling of MS-Office products is essential, as is knowledge of the fire brigade organization. Experience with Jira and Confluence are considered an advantage. A high service orientation, teamwork, flexibility and the willingness of additional services as well as a class B driver's license are also required.
